Firefall is an original acrylic painting.  It is 24” x 30” and is set in a black floating frame, ready to hang.

I am the first one to admit that sometimes intention has no place in my paintings.  Often, the more intention with which I approach a painting, the more chance I will not fulfill my intention.  Firefall was intended to be a piece in my Stark Series.  There is nothing remotely stark about this painting, so intention gets an epic fail on this one. However, I do love the outcome and so Firefall will have to stand alone.

The piercing reds, yellows and oranges of the leaves in the fall can almost look like fire licking at the tree trunks and filling the sky.  There is such an unspeakable brilliance to the intensity of the colors in the density of a forested area. It’s hard to imagine, it’s hard to replicate, but I give you my version with Firefall.
